Hola amigos de ayuda excel, necesito su ayuda con un tema que puede resultar simple pero que no e podido encontrar solucion.
Tengo un problema al hacer una seleccion en un combo de una pagina web a traves de una macro de excel, el problema de este combo es que posee un onchange para cargar el segundo combobox.
el codigo que utilizo funciona correctamente con los text pero e buscado de distintas formas y no e podido que me carge el segundo combox.
Set ie = CreateObject("InternetExplorer.application")
Cabe mencionar que inicia correctamente si es que tuviera un select (ya lo e probado) el problema radica en que a mis pocos conocimientos no e podido encontrar solucion a que ejecute el onchange para poder cargar el segundo combobox.
Nota: Esta macro la estoy haciendo debido a que en el trabajo debo diariamente ingresar a varios portales y queria hacerlo con un solo boton.
Muchas gracias a quien me de un guia, ayuda o solucion, estaria muy agradecido.
Saludos a todos.
Featured Replies
Archivado
Este tema está ahora archivado y está cerrado a más respuestas.
Hola amigos de ayuda excel, necesito su ayuda con un tema que puede resultar simple pero que no e podido encontrar solucion.
Tengo un problema al hacer una seleccion en un combo de una pagina web a traves de una macro de excel, el problema de este combo es que posee un onchange para cargar el segundo combobox.
el codigo que utilizo funciona correctamente con los text pero e buscado de distintas formas y no e podido que me carge el segundo combox.
Set ie = CreateObject("InternetExplorer.application")
ie.Visible = True
ie.Navigate ("https://www.paginaweb.com")
Do
If ie.ReadyState = 4 Then
ie.Visible = True
Exit Do
Else
DoEvents
End If
Loop
'Este es el combobox uno el que posee el onchange para cargar el segundo
ie.document.forms(0).all("pai").value = "ven"
'Este el combobox que se deberia cargar
'ie.document.forms(0).all("uni").Value = "Super"
'Estos dos campos se llenan correctamente y el boton se ejecuta bien
ie.document.forms(0).all("log").Value = "login"
ie.document.forms(0).all("password").Value = "pass"
'Boton
ie.document.forms(0).all("ing").Click
Cabe mencionar que inicia correctamente si es que tuviera un select (ya lo e probado) el problema radica en que a mis pocos conocimientos no e podido encontrar solucion a que ejecute el onchange para poder cargar el segundo combobox.
Nota: Esta macro la estoy haciendo debido a que en el trabajo debo diariamente ingresar a varios portales y queria hacerlo con un solo boton.
Muchas gracias a quien me de un guia, ayuda o solucion, estaria muy agradecido.
Saludos a todos.